Lala Lajpat Rai founded the 'Tilak School of Politics' in Lahore (1926), naming it after Lokmanya Tilak to propagate his political ideas among youth. Bipinchandra Pal was a Bengal extremist contemporary of Tilak but did not establish this institution; Shripad Amrut Dange was a later communist labour leader; Arvind Ghosh (Aurobindo) was a revolutionary-nationalist writer, not the founder of this Lahore school.
